Air permeable insulation such as fiberglass batts dense packed cellulose or blown in fiberglass can t be used alone for an unvented assembly since these types of insulation can allow moist indoor air to reach the cold roof sheathing leading to condensation or moisture accumulation.

A cathedral ceiling is often difficult to insulate as they leave very little room for ventilation which is needed to keep the insulation dry.

An unvented assembly can perform well but it s important to get the details right to avoid sheathing rot.
